Benzibiotic (1.2 Million Unit) 1 Injection
Benzathine benzylpenicillin 1.2 million units injection for streptococcal infections.
Benzibiotic (1.2 Million Unit) is benzathine benzylpenicillin, a long-acting penicillin injection for the treatment of streptococcal infections (e.g. pharyngitis, rheumatic fever prophylaxis) and syphilis. Administered by deep intramuscular injection only; not for IV use.
Purpose
Treatment of streptococcal pharyngitis; secondary prevention of rheumatic fever; treatment of syphilis when prescribed.
Ingredients
Benzathine benzylpenicillin 1.2 million units per injection.
Warnings
Contraindicated in penicillin hypersensitivity. Administer only by trained personnel. Have adrenaline available for anaphylaxis. Not for IV use.
Side Effects
Pain at injection site, allergic reactions including anaphylaxis. Rare: procaine reaction if procaine penicillin is confused. Report rash, swelling, or difficulty breathing.
Storage Instructions
Store in refrigerator (2–8°C). Protect from light. Use before expiry. Allow to reach room temperature before injection.
